Chang Kim and Aviram Jenik from Rabbit Ventures talk about the Korean startup ecosystem and how Korean startups can enter the US market. Guests include startup founders, VCs, investors and other interesting people from the Korean startup ecosystem.

Startups with Seoul Ep 7 - Jiwon Hong of Yesplz.ai

Jiwon shares her journey from a big company to her own startup, sales technics, and life hack tips.

Main takeaways:
1. "I always wanted to start my own company... It was the right time. My mission was working with startups for open innovation and tech sourcing... That's where I got to experience the startup ecosystem, and I didn't want to be a supporter any longer. I wanted to build and experience the whole journey."

2. "We quickly built a product that visual filter right idea... we called it the mannequin filter... from there we just quickly built it."

3/ "Don't come to the US until you have a client... everything now, I make my sales call over Zoom, and my clients find me through Google... organic search."
